NOZZLE FOR CLEANER

A nozzle for a cleaner includes a nozzle housing including a suction flow path through which air including dust flows and at least a portion of which extends in a front and rear direction. First and second rotation cleaning units are arranged on the lower side of the nozzle housing to be spaced apart from each other in a lateral direction. Each of the first and second rotation cleaning units includes a rotation plate adapted for attachment of a mop. A first driving device including a first driving motor drives the first rotation cleaning unit and a second driving device including a second driving motor drives the second rotation cleaning unit. A water tank mounted on the nozzle stores water to be supplied to the mop.

CLEANING ROBOT
20210161348 · 2021-06-03 ·

A cleaning robot includes a main body, a drive assembly and a cleaning assembly. The main body includes a bottom part. The cleaning assembly includes a mounting part, a wiping part and a release part. The mounting part is positioned on the bottom part. The mounting part includes a first rail, a second rail, and a first positioning part. The wiping part is positioned on the mounting part and includes a second positioning part, the wiping part is movable from first ends of the first rail and the second rail to second ends thereof until the second positioning part abuts against the first positioning part whereby the wiping part is fixed on the mounting part. The release part is positioned on the mounting part and configured to separate the second positioning part from the first positioning part whereby the wiping part is detached from the mounting part.

CLEANING DEVICE

Apparatus and method for receiving and holding debris in a collection chamber of a vacuum cleaner. A cleaning head is coupled to a body of the vacuum cleaner via one or more suspension elements that comply to horizontal oscillations of the cleaning head imparted by an offset bearing of a vertical gear drive driven by a motor mounted to the body. A vacuum source draws air in from a suction nozzle at a forward underside portion of the cleaning head adjacent to a cleaning pad, and the air travels through an air filter disposed between the vacuum source and the collection chamber. In some embodiments, the air filter comprises one or more pleats adjacent to the vacuum source.
